The podcast where DJ Louie XIV and guests completely overanalyze all your favorite pop stars, then rank them in the official Pop Pantheon.

The Majesty of Rosalia's Lux (with Suzy Exposito) (Patreon Patreon)
Q: What is Rosalia's story as a musical tourist, and how has she faced criticism for cultural appropriation?
Suzy explains that while Rosalia was not from the region where flamenco originated, she embraced the style academically. Rosalia approaches different musical styles out of respect and curiosity, aiming to honor these traditions rather than appropriate them.

Frequently Asked Questions About Pop Pantheon

What is Pop Pantheon about and what kind of topics does it cover?

This podcast features in-depth discussions surrounding popular music and its illustrious stars, with a focus on analysis and ranking within a conceptual "Pop Pantheon." Episodes often examine the artistry, cultural significance, and career trajectories of diverse pop icons, such as Katy Perry, Nicole Scherzinger, and Rosalia. The hosts engage with listeners through various segments, including listener mailbags and previews of upcoming music, creating an interactive atmosphere. It stands out for its blend of scholarly insight and entertaining commentary, appealing to both music enthusiasts and casual listeners alike.
